CFPB: ACE Money Express Must Spend $10M For Pushing Borrowers Into Cash Advance Cycle Of Financial Obligation
The buyer Financial Protection Bureau announced Thursday it was searching for an enforcement action against ACE money Express, among the biggest payday loan providers in the us, for allegedly participating in unlawful commercial collection agency techniques to be able to push customers into taking right out extra loans they are able to perhaps not pay for.
Texas-based ACE will offer $5 million in refunds to customers together with having to pay a $5 million penalty when it comes to violations that are alleged.
ACE, which currently runs on the internet and through 1,500 retail storefronts in 36 states, provides pay day loans, check-cashing services, name loans, installment loans as well as other products that are financial.
Regulators state they discovered that ACE and its own third-party collection operators utilized illegal strategies such as for example harassment and false threats of legal actions and prosecution that is criminal stress customers to obtain extra loans.
A diagram from ACE’s training manual illustrates the period of financial obligation for payday borrowers.
In accordance with the above visual, customers start with deciding on ACE for the loan, which ACE approves. Next, in the event that customer “exhausts the instance and will not are able to spend,” ACE “contacts the consumer for re re payment or provides the solution to refinance or extend the mortgage.” Then, as soon as the customer “does perhaps maybe perhaps maybe not make a payment plus the account comes into collectors,” the cycle starts all over again – with all the borrower that is formerly overdue for another cash advance.
Although the example offers a troubling image of methods found in the lending that is payday, officials with ACE state in a news release PDF Thursday that the organization has policies set up to stop delinquent borrowers from taking out fully brand new loans:
“A client by having a delinquent account just isn’t permitted to just just take away another loan with ACE before the past loan is paid down. Also, ACE will not charge any extra charges or interest on reports in collections and will be offering a payment plan choice where, one per year, clients may elect a four-payment interest-free payment want to pay back a superb loan stability.”
Pay day loans are designed to get customers away from crisis monetary circumstances, but more and more consumers utilize the loans to help make ends fulfill for a daily basis. This trend is becoming worrisome for regulators and customer advocacy teams.
Back in March, the CFPB circulated a research that uncovered four away from five loans that are payday rolled over or renewed every fourteen days by borrowers whom find yourself spending more in fees compared to the quantity of their initial loan.
The CFPB discovered that by renewing or rolling over loans the common month-to-month borrower is prone to stay static in financial obligation for 11 months or longer. As well as supplying refunds and having to pay a penalty, ACE’s enthusiasts are prohibited from utilizing unlawful business collection agencies strategies and try to avoid pressuring customers into rounds of financial obligation.
After the CFPB statement Thursday, officials with ACE state in a news launch that some other, separate expert evaluated a “statistically significant, random test of ACE collection phone telephone phone calls.”
Relating to ACE, the review “indicated that a lot more than 96 per cent of ACE’s calls through the review duration came across appropriate collections criteria.”
The business additionally states that more than the last couple of years this has cooperated completely utilizing the CFPB to make usage of conformity modifications and improvements and responding for papers and information.
